JR2 was built when we had our son living with us and the boatmans cabin was ideal for him. Also I wanted a vintage Gardner. However, a 71' 6" Hudson boat weighing in at over 26 tonnes before fuel and possessions were on board proved too much for Jenny to handle and she said she needed 4 hands to steer, control the throttle, change gear and work the bow thruster (yes, one was fitted!) Also son left home a few years ago and we no longer need all that space.
We therefore decided to sell and downsize.and Elouise fitted the bill admirably.
